面向安卓系统的手写公式计算器开发手写公式识别(4)
时间:2018-06-12 11:26 来源:毕业论文 作者:毕业论文 点击:次
JAVA自从被推出面世后发展非常迅速,在各类语言运用中形成了强烈的冲击且流传迅速,在科技领域里开启了快速发展的启动模式乃至其风格非常接近C语言,C ++语言,但同时它也汲取了C ++的特性,利用类的优点封装了数据,实现了简单和易文护的特性。对于封装类,继承和目标程序等相关特征,只需要编译一次程序代码,然后便可反复使用的上述特点。程序员可以用它来专注于在全球云计算的设计和应用的类和接口和移动,在这互联网高速发展时代,Java语言的开辟之路将会走的更久更远。 2。1。2 JAVA开发环境的搭建 平台由Java虚拟机和Java应用编程接口构成,它的应用编程接口也为此提供了一个独立于操作系统的标准接口,可分为基本部分和扩展部分。在硬件或操作系统平台上安装一个Java平台之后,Java应用程序就可运行。Java平台已经嵌入了几乎所有的操作系统,这样Java程序可以只编译一次,就可以在各种系统中运行。 由于此次课题选择JAVA来编译,因此在安卓平台上将首先引入Java语言的环境开发。在我们搭建开发环境之前,首当其冲需要注意Java语言的搭建包括了三个部分: JDK下载、安装及配置。JDK是整个Java的核心,包括了Java运行环境(Java Runtime Envirnment),一堆Java工具和Java基础的类库(rt。jar),可以与JDK升级的Java(J2EE,J2SE以及J2ME)版本升级。 为了使JDK的开发方案Java程序可以快速地理解代码的各个部分之间的关系,这也有利于理解Java面向对象的设计。但另一个角度来说,java语言很难从事大规模企业级应用,因为如今还没有较为复杂的Java软件开发,也不利于几种软件的合作发展。 2、MySql的下载、安装及配置,它是一款非常优秀的开源数据库管理系统 3、应用服务器的下载、安装及配置。 图2。1 Java环境开发示意图 2。2 关于Android 要完成本课题的内容需要一个良好的开发环境,在本节中将要介绍安卓系统的起源和一些热门的开发平台,据此选择开发环境的搭建并阐述选择其的理由。 2。2。1 安卓系统的起源及概念 2007年11月5日,安卓系统在谷歌公司应运而生。它是一个基于Linux的开源操作系统,主要用于手机,平板电脑等高科技便携设备。该平台由操作系统,中间件,用户界面和应用软件等几大部分组成,面世以来安卓系统被称为是移动终端打造的第一个真正开放的移动平台。 这是一个拥有很多特色的系统,尤其他独一无二的开放性和免费服务创造了一个第三方软件完全开放的平台,开发者可以在其中更自由的编译程序而不受条条框框的约束限制。它使用的软件体系结构层的堆叠层,底层为Linux内核工作,众所周知,它是基于C语言的开发,因此只提供一些基础功能;中间层包括:库库和虚拟机虚拟机,不同于底层的是,它是基于C + +的开发。顶层是各种各样的应用,包括呼叫程序,SMS程序,公司同时也开发应用软件部分,这也是以Java作为编译过程的一部分。 在安卓成为谷歌公司的大力支持开发后,谷歌将尽一切办法来促进实现他们的业务目标:随时随地提供信息的每个人。虽然安卓系统以大量普及,但全球移动电话用户中还有许多用户仍未使用过安卓相关的移动设备,据此,安卓也将继续进行修改和补充,而不是取代谷歌曾奉行的战略发展,将安卓系统推行成为真正的便民移动服务,走入千家万户。 (责任编辑:qin) |